Gold can be mixed with other metals like copper, which is used in red gold, or mercury, which is used in dental gold. Gold is a very pliable metal and its melting point is relatively low; therefore, refining it by melting it and extracting the other metals from it is a practical process.

Nov 16, 2019· However, if the gold is more pure (or is an external plating), what actually happens is that the nitric acid tries to dissolve everything, but the gold blocks it from coming through. In that case, you purify an outer layer, but the internal layers are not pure because they are protected by an insoluble layer of gold.

The process of parting gold with nitric acid is old, and probably dates from the discovery of nitric acid itself; it is one of the simplest parting processes, and does not require a costly plant or much manipulative skill. The main objection to it is the cost of the acid. The operation comprises the preparation of .

A process routinely employed in the fire assaying of gold ores is the addition of silver prior to fusion of the ore in order to ensure that the silver content of the final bead is high enough to dissolve. This is called inquartation, and the separating of silver and gold by leaching with nitric acid is referred to as parting.

Gold refining with Nitric Acid by inquarting Silver is a way to refining through the process of separating gold from silver. Steps include measuring jewelry weight, then calculating the amount of silver that is needed to properly reduce gold content down to 6k, producing the correct balance.
